Kpop edits have become a popular way for fans around the world to express their love for their favorite groups and idols. These edits often blend vibrant colors, creative transitions, and dynamic effects to highlight the energy and charisma of Kpop stars. Whether you're an aspiring editor or a dedicated fan, creating Kpop edits can be a rewarding hobby that connects you with a large, passionate community. One popular trend in Kpop editing is to add personalized touches that reflect the editor's unique style. This might include floral motifs like cherry blossoms or fresh, citrus elements such as lemons, which add a whimsical and refreshing feel to visuals. Combining these elements with high-quality images and smooth animations can make your edits stand out. If you're new to Kpop editing, start by exploring basic editing software that supports layers and effects. Tutorials on social media platforms can guide you through using key features such as masking, overlays, and color grading. Following talented creators on Lemon8 or similar platforms allows you to observe their techniques and gather inspiration. Joining fan communities dedicated to Kpop editing offers opportunities to share your work, receive feedback, and participate in collaborative projects. These communities often organize challenges or themed events to encourage creativity. By regularly practicing your editing skills and staying updated with the latest trends in Kpop culture, you can develop your artistic voice and contribute meaningful, high-quality content to the fandom. Embracing creativity and authenticity is key to making your Kpop edits resonate with others and enriching your fan experience.
